Overview

The medicinal chemistry team within the Center for Drug Discovery supports client needs by conducting hit-to-lead and lead optimization. We integrate medicinal chemistry into larger projects focused on drug discovery and development, including computational chemistry, in vitro assay development and HTS screening, in vivo behavioral pharmacology, ADME/PK bioanalytics, and regulatory support.

We have an immediate need for a Medicinal Chemist to join our dynamic and rapidly expanding team. We are on the lookout for a highly motivated and organized individual who is eager to dive into the synthesis of monomers, building blocks, peptides, and oligonucleotides. In this exciting role, candidate will create innovative ligands targeting a range of biological challenges, including kinases, G protein-coupled receptors, ion channels, and antimicrobial agents.

At RTI, you will be provided the opportunity to conduct meaningful work in a collaborative, cross functional environment. We are focused on your career development and provide a generous benefits package that includes tuition reimbursement, parental leave, paid time off, medical/dental, and 401K.

This position is a two-year term assignment with potential for annual renewal.


Responsibilities

  • Assist with experimental design.
  • Perform compound synthesis independently or as a member of a team.
  • Ensure proper execution of studies and record-keeping.
  • Perform data analyses and prepare manuscripts for publication.
  • Attend conferences to present novel research findings.
  • Assist with grant applications and laboratory management.
  • Train junior investigators and technicians as needed.
  • Review literature and patents to retrieve scientific information.
  • Other duties as assigned by PI.

Qualifications

  • Ph.D. in synthetic or medicinal chemistry or a related discipline field of study.
  • Proven expertise in solid-phase peptide and oligonucleotide synthesis.
  • Well-demonstrated and extensive experience with a variety of chemical reactions.
  • Proficiency in utilizing RP-HPLC, LC/MS, NMR, and chiral separation techniques.
  • Highly desirable to have experience in cell cultures and/or biological assays.
  • Desirable to possess knowledge of basic computational techniques.
  • Adept at working independently in a fast-paced environment.
  • Proficient in English.
